Output 55dfe895dffb075f3bad66b9e7c0fadddd7e25a8b362dc5ae9776989eb0303c4:94

value
715660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75a522571d438e4d59a88212cc1b0efe99f647b5 OP_EQUAL
address
3CR4oi66yPfM6fs5V4ceuBLyCaJo3pDpiQ
transaction
55dfe895dffb075f3bad66b9e7c0fadddd7e25a8b362dc5ae9776989eb0303c4
confirmations
167737
spent
true